KSEEB has been conducting the SSLC exams since it came into existence in 1966. Last year close to 8.73 lakhs students appeared for these exams. This year the number has gone up. Numbers of students opt for the state board exams to get their Secondary School Leaving Certificate.
Last year the result was announced on May 10. Delay in this year’s results has been due to rescheduling of the common entrance test for medical, pharmacy and engineering admissions to undergraduate programs in Karnataka colleges
Karnataka CET is mandatory exam for those students who want to take admission in engineering and medical college in the state. The result for the exam was declared on 30th May, 2011. Aditya Gaonkar from Bangalore tops the chart of ranking in the exam.
